Key Takeaways
- Layer at least three shades of pink (blush, dusty rose, hot pink) to avoid a flat, one-note look
- Swap traditional gold or silver tree toppers for an oversized pale pink velvet bow to anchor the palette
- Use white or cream as a neutral base so pink accents read as intentional decor rather than leftover Valentine stock
- Mix matte and glossy pink ornament finishes on the same branch to add depth without adding extra color
- Extend the pink theme to the wreath with dried pampas grass and blush ribbon for a textured, modern front-door statement
